The fortified region was tasked with covering the Turkish border from Chakhmakh to Karavabad, the Leninakan sector.

[2] In July 1946, the 55th Fortified Region was reorganized as the 17th Machine Gun Artillery Brigade, becoming part of the 7th Guards Army.

Its existence as a brigade proved brief as it was reorganized as the 17th Machine Gun Artillery Division just a few months later on 13 August.
